Weather in September

The first month of the autumn, September, is also an agreeable month in Haines Falls, New York, with an average temperature varying between 51.4°F (10.8°C) and 71.4°F (21.9°C).

Temperature

In September, the average high-temperature marginally drops from a moderately hot 78.4°F (25.8°C) in August to a pleasant 71.4°F (21.9°C). In September, the temperature drops to an average of 51.4°F (10.8°C) at night.

Humidity

In Haines Falls, New York, the average relative humidity in September is 79%.

Rainfall

September is the month with the least rainfall. Rain falls for 12.5 days and accumulates 1.97" (50m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

In Haines Falls, snow does not fall in June through September.

Daylight

In Haines Falls, the average length of the day in September is 12h and 28min.
On the first day of September, sunrise is at 6:22 am and sunset at 7:29 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:53 am and sunset at 6:39 pm EDT.

Sunshine

In September, the average sunshine is 9.1h.

UV index

The average daily maximum UV index in September in Haines Falls is 3. A UV Index value of 3 to 5 symbolizes a moderate health risk from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the ordinary person.
Note: In September, the average maximum UV index of 3 translates into the following recommendations:
Adopt protective measures - Suggestions to resist sunburn are offered. The Sun's most harmful UV rays are emitted around midday; avoid staying outdoors for long during this time. A wide-brimmed hat is a staple for defending the face, eyes, ears, and neck from the Sun.
